On Margaret Mead’s Birthday

Anthropologist Mary Catherine Bateson is the daughter of Margaret Mead and Gregory Bateson, both anthropologists. On Margaret Mead’s birthday (December 16, 1901), she speaks about Margaret Mead’s suggestion of Armenian as the international language, as well as her own thoughts about the impact of that on the Armenian language. She also speaks about the value of intercultural communication both for a new country like Armenia, as well as the ancient Armenian nation, based on her experiences living in the Middle East with her husband Barkev Kassarjian.
